This rarely seen vintage Buren dive watch has a pristine gray satin dial that is free of any scratching, tool marks, defects or chipping. The original lume on the dial and hands, which remains fully intact and emits a quick-burst glow after being exposed to bright light, has aged beautifully to a perfectly matching golden buttermilk hue. The slightly faded black bezel, which smoothly rotates bidirectionally, looks good. The heavy duty all stainless steel case is built like a tank and is in wonderful condition, free of any visibly noticeable dents or dings. There appears to be a very light inscription on the back of one of the lugs which in person is visually imperceptible. The outer edge of the case back is stamped “SHOCKRESISTANT ANTIMAGNETIC STAINLESS STEEL CASE BASE METAL INDICATOR” with “TESTED TO A DEPTH OF 600 FEET 100% WATERRESISTANT AND CONDENSATION PROOF” stamped around the inner edge. The inside of the case back is stamped W. ” followed by “CASE MADE IN HONG KONG. While the integrity of the crystal is intact it should be replaced as it is heavily scratched. When unscrewing the approximate 4 mm HEV screwdown crown to the second position to set the date and time, the seconds hand immediately fires up. By moving the watch in a brisk, circular motion the power reserve can be built up for several hours. During this time the movement keeps near perfect time. However, when the crown is pulled out to the first position to wind the movement, there is no friction. Therefore, an adjustment will need to be made by a skilled watchmaker. Additionally it feels as though the oscillating weight moves a bit too freely and may benefit from being tightened. The quickset date function works flawlessly by pulling the crown out to the second position, rolling over a new date and then moving the hour hand repeatedly between the 20.5 and 24 hour marks until the desired date has been reached. Considering the movement’s unknown service history (although there are watchmaker service markings on the inside of the case back it has likely been several decades since the movement was last serviced) a complete overhaul is recommended. This watch measures approximately 37 mm excluding the crown, approximately 41 mm including the crown and approximately 19 mm between the lugs. Case thickness, measured from the bottom of the case back to the top of the bezel, is approximately 9.5 mm. Including the crystal case thickness measures approximately 12 mm. This classy vintage early 1970’s Waltham dive watch with rarely seen Explorer-style dial looks great. The smoky black satin “T Swiss Made T” signed dial looks beautiful, free of any noticeable scratching, chipping, tool marks or defects. All of the dial text and printing is intact and vibrant. The patina of the dial lume dots match the patina of the hands precisely, having aged to a warm and inviting golden buttermilk hue. The original tritium on the dial and hands, which remains fully intact, no longer glows after being exposed to bright light. The vibrant orange seconds hand gives this watch a wonderful energy. The silver bezel, which freely rotates bidirectionally, looks good. The heavy, all stainless steel case appears to be in excellent unpolished condition, showing some scratching but free of any dents, dings or oxidation/rust. The outside of the case back is engraved ALL STAINLESS STEEL CASE AUTOMATIC SWISS MADE WALTHAM. ” The inside of the case back is stamped “WATHAM WATCH Co” followed by “SWISS MADE, 17412-84-5, B339″ and “905. The integrity of the crystal is intact but there is significant scratching. Please note that while the dial appears to be in nearly flawless condition, over time some dust/debris has gotten between the crystal and crystal ring, settling on the underbelly of the crystal and onto the dial. After recently winding the original “W” signed crown 39 full revolutions the watch had a solid power reserve of approximately 38 hours. The crown winds smoothly. Considering that this watch is over 40 years old and likely hasn’t been serviced in several decades (there is a watchmaker service engraving on the inside of the case back), a complete overhaul is suggested. This watch measures approximately 36 mm excluding the crown, approximately 39 mm including the crown and approximately 18 mm between the lugs. Case thickness, measured from the bottom of the case back to the top of the bezel, is approximately 10.5 mm. Including the crystal case thickness measures approximately 12.5 mm.
